java google appspot应用程序可以移动到另一台服务器吗?

时间:2012-10-20 23:40:45

标签: java google-app-engine gwt

可以将我在appspot.com托管的应用移动到另一台服务器。 如果是这样,步骤和要求是什么? 我的应用程序是使用gae java在eclipse中完成的

提前致谢!

2 个答案:

答案 0 :(得分:1)

不可能像现在这样完全采用您的代码,将其设置在不同的服务器中并运行。即使您的整个代码与App Engine无关,您的数据存储模型也可能不是。因此,首先需要定义要移动到的开发环境,然后修改代码以正确处理它。

就您当前的数据而言,您需要创建一个“迁移工具”,它将从App Engine获取数据并将其导入新环境。

希望这有帮助。

答案 1 :(得分:0)

Google Appengine不对您的代码运行的主机提供任何控制。如果您已设置付费应用,则可以更改应用设置上的内存/ CPU配置文件,可以假设您的应用实例需要在其他虚拟机中运行。您还可以关闭实例(在实例页面上)。如果没有实例正在运行,则会在下一个请求中创建一个新实例,并且不太可能在与之前运行该应用程序的虚拟机相同的虚拟机上运行。